Chandigarh, September 21 

The Mahatma Gandhi Peace Club of the Institute of Educational Technology and Vocational Education (IETVE), Panjab University, celebrated International Day of Peace on the theme: The Right to Peace - The universal declaration of human rights at 70”, here on Friday. 

The celebrations were started with tree plantation on the campus. The students delivered speeches, presentations and participated in face-painting competitions.  Ankit, Mandeep and Japsimran bagged first, second and third positions in presentations, respectively. Nisha, Nehal, Reetika and Jyoti stood first, second and third in face-painting contest, respectively. — TNS
